Last week, our Head of Museum & Heritage, Melissa Barnett, gave a talk on 'The History of Chippenham through its Lost Pubs', to the North Wilts U3A History & Archaeology group. Some attendees shared memories of these pubs, adding to Melissa’s research.

Discover the post-war book designs of Stephen Russ at Chippenham Museum. Coming soon, this exhibition celebrates his work, from Graham Greene first editions to Penguin covers and the famous 'Lady Chatterley’s Lover' phoenix, as well as his 30-year teaching career at the Bath Academy of Art, Corsham.

Sheona Beaumont’s β€˜Night Tide Under Clifton Suspension Bridge’ captures the landmark at night. Passing traffic & reflections, combined with long exposure & a staggered zoom, create shimmering pencils of light.

In Wilks’ narrative painting, motherhood is seen from the child’s perspective. Much of her work relates to still life & autobiographical themes. 'Hair Doing' is part of the wider series, which draws on memories of growing up in South Gloucestershire.
